Hi All, Just started working with a new print core, the AA 0.8, and I'll have an occasional issue where the Z height isn't calibrated correctly and the hot end will scrape across the face of the print bed after calibration and while the print is starting, plugging the filament into the core and scraping up the bed. This happens every time I attempt to do a dual extrusion print with with the AA 0.8 print core and only sometimes when printing with just the AA 0.8 core. I can't quite tell the rhyme or reason to what causes it. One file printed just fine, but when I reoriented the print by 90 degrees, it scraped across the bed. I'll attached a picture, just incase that's got any clues on it, as well as the gcode. Running Cura 5.6.0 and firmware 8.3.1. Any advice would be appreciated. Thanks! UMS5_Corrugated.ufp
